General information

Background: In existence for more than 100 years; present building opened in 1967; typical of 1960s architecture, with bright, airy interior; grass and tarmac playing areas. Offers Catholic education to residents of five villages, formerly coal-mining communities; promotes family atmosphere, supporting all aspects of pupils' education. School is pleased with support from parents, both within school curriculum and after school; local police, librarians, parish representatives, health visitors and local football team are all regular visitors to the school. In 1998, won National Heritage Grant (Scotland Area) to 'help develop a more stimulating environment for play and learning'. With help of RSPB, school hopes to create specific learning areas within its garden, linked to Scottish guidelines for environmental studies. 'With a real spirit of partnership, parents, pupils and staff are able to make the school a vibrant, rewarding centre for learning.' .
